Troops Search for Kidnappers in Jungle
From Times Wire Reports
President Alvaro Arzu vowed to track down a heavily armed gang that briefly kidnapped a family of U.S. evangelicals, as troops scoured thick jungle in search of the culprits. The six-hour ordeal ended Monday in a commando raid when a military patrol stumbled on the captors, who fled. Officials said the kidnapping did not appear to be a political crime, and the family said it will remain in the country.
